Congenital Heart Defect: A Story about Little Hearts
Congenital heart defects (CHD) are the most common form of birth defects, affecting over 7 in 1,000 children worldwide. In Asia, the prevalence is about 9.3 per 1,000 births. A CHD doesn’t necessarily have to be life-threatening — about 75–85% of children born with CHD will live well into adulthood.
What Is a Congenital Heart Defect?
Congenital means present at birth. CHDs refer to a group of heart defects arising from issues in the development of one or more parts of the heart during early foetal development. Common signs and symptoms include:
Abnormal heart sound (heart murmur)
Rapid breathing
Low blood pressure or low oxygen levels
Blue or purple tint to the skin due to lack of oxygen
Causes: Genetic and Non-Genetic
Most forms of CHD have no known single cause. CHD is a complex condition with a variety of genetic and environmental contributors.
Non-genetic risk factors:
Environmental teratogens — pesticides, dioxins, polychlorinated biphenyls
Maternal exposure to alcohol, thalidomide, anti-seizure medications, or infections such as rubella
Obesity, diabetes, and high cholesterol
Genetic contributors:
Syndromic CHD: Heart defects occurring as part of a genetic syndrome such as Down syndrome, Turner syndrome, or 22q11.2 deletion syndrome
Single gene changes: Disease-causing changes in genes involved in normal heart development before birth
Management
Many CHDs can be detected during routine pregnancy ultrasound at 16–20 weeks. Simple defects may need minor or no management — some correct themselves as children grow. Others may require surgery within hours of birth. Despite high success rates, many children in India are not diagnosed in time due to lack of prenatal care, awareness, and funds.
Precautions During Pregnancy
Receive vaccination against Rubella
Take folic acid supplements
Speak with your doctor about all medications during pregnancy, including herbal remedies
Avoid exposure to chemicals such as dry-cleaning agents and paint thinners
Avoid smoking and alcohol
Maintain a healthy diet with good blood sugar control

Genetic Counselling for Congenital Heart Defects
If you are an adult with a history of CHD, or a parent of a child with CHD, speaking with a genetic counsellor can help you understand the diagnosis, assess recurrence risk, and discuss emotional and medical implications for your family.
